Meguiars Quik Wax

It doesn't really last very long (protection wise), and bottle wise.

You'll probably get 2 weeks from it, and it can't be used with water.

Use a normal wax for protection.

If you're looking for something to keep it topped up (weekly etc), then use a wet/aqua wax, such as Duragloss Aqua wax, or AutoGlyms. You use these after you've rinsed the car, it acts as a drying aid too.
